Check out this price list: http://www.santaanaplating.com/site/price_list.htm
My guess is something like this would cost everybit of $15,000+, and I think that is pretty conservative.
You have to consider something - this is for a lot of very big parts. That means a lot more prep work, etc.

I'd think the chrome might flake once there is a chip and sort of spread. Not to mention the glare from the sun (on you and other drivers) seems dangerous. Then there is always the concern of getting dinged and redoing a whole part of the car. Definately looks amazing though.
